A shampoo from Ronney that contains hyaluronic acid which deeply moisturizes the hair. Thanks to this, your hair will be smoothed out and will not lose moisture.
How to use: Apply a small amount of the shampoo to wet hair, gently massage the scalp for 1-2 minutes, then rinse the hair thoroughly. Repeat the action if necessary.
